Symptoms Can Include:
- Neck pain, sometimes pain in the shoulder blade and even into the arm.
- Can include muscle spasms
- Decreased range of motion in the neck, may include inability to turn one’s head or look up and down without pain.
- Overhead activities and long periods of sitting can aggravate pain.
- “Cracking” or “crunching” sensation
